Our Enterprise summer placements provide real hands-on experience through a 12-week placement in our Solar and Battery Delivery team. The candidate will gain a robust knowledge of the Project Delivery function, supporting the delivery of projects at the construction phases, including handover to operations. You can expect to spend time both in the office and out at our construction sites, gaining experience and insight into modern project management techniques as well as developing an understand of construction supply chains and the role they play in SSE achieving its net zero targets. Throughout the placement, you will have the support of a business mentor and buddy who will provide guidance to enable you to reach your full potential.
Our summer placement students work collaboratively in a variety of contexts, while also taking ownership of their role by working under their own direction to drive action forward. There will also be networking and presentation opportunities, specialist sessions and support from our graduates.

About our business
SSE Energy Solutions website
The division offers a full range of services across diverse markets, which contribute to development of smart cities and smart places, in both public and private sectors including; Electric vehicle infrastructure for public mass transportation and vehicle fleets, Electricity networks including building, owning, and adopting private HV networks and Distributed energy systems including renewable and low-carbon generation, energy storage and demand management services. It’s an expanding, exciting and leading Energy business at the forefront of the UK’s transition to net zero.
